"In the early days of America, a common form of endentured servitude was "peonage", where one paid for the costs of one's passage by contracting oneself into the bonded servitide of he who funded the trip (or his designee). While these resemble voluntary contracts, the obligation and performance are so lopsided, and with the undesirable nature of the concentraton of power that ensues, such arrangements are generally considered to have been prohibited under the 13th Amendment. "
